Output 2881f84ed1a42a395648e06a240318d0498bfe3d22236ad0aa978b8b31f5c795: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d922ce5d92d9777010003d4af17a42010acc123f OP_EQUAL
address
3MV8FYQN1emuYgZpjPfvx38comGAXuG3yS
transaction
2881f84ed1a42a395648e06a240318d0498bfe3d22236ad0aa978b8b31f5c795
spent
true